Route No.1

  • NATURE OF TRIP : Biking and camping
  • DURATION : 11N /12D (Delhi to Srinagar)
  • WHO CAN JOIN : Open for Solo Travellers, Couples, and Group of Friends
  • BEST SEASON : May to October
  • ROUTE : Delhi – Kullu/Manali – Jispa – Bara lacha la Pass – Sarchu – Leh – Khardung La Pass – Nubra Valley – Turtuk Village – Nubra Valley – Pangong Lake – Leh – Kargil – Srinagr.

Itinerary

DAY 01: DELHI TO KULLU/MANALI | 540 KM | 14-15 HOURS.

• Arrival at Delhi, board a Volvo bus to Manali from Delhi. It will be an overnight journey so make sure that you are well prepared.

DAY 02: ARRIVAL AT KULLU/MANALI.

• Once you reach Kullu/Manali, check in at the pre-booked hotel. Rest for some time and get ready for an orientation process and tour briefing.
• Today it’s a rest and acclimatization day. You may enjoy a relaxing nature walk on your own to Hadimba Temple, and Manu temple in Old Manalivillage.
• Hadimba Temple is truly one-of-a-kind, as it is dedicated to Hadimba Devi, wife of the mighty Bhima from the Hindu epic Mahabharata.
• Manu Temple is located near the river Beas is dedicated to sage Manu, the creator of the world.
• Overnight Stay at Kullu/Manali.
• Meals : Breakfast & Dinner

DAY 03: MANALI - JIPSA/BILING | 110 KM | 3-4 HOURS.

• Your long-awaited ride to Ladakh finally begins on this day. Pack your bags and get set for a thrilling trip.
• On the way, you will pass Vashisht Hot Springs. Although Manali is known for its freezing temperatures, these hot springs which are located 6 km from the town have temperatures ranging from 43-50 °C.
• You will then visit Solang Valley, known for a variety of winter sports.
• Overnight camp stay at Jispa/Biling.
• Meals : Breakfast & Dinner

DAY 04: JISPA - SARCHU | 90 KM | 4-5 HOURS.

• On this day, gear up for an adventure as you cross the 16,043-ft-high Bara-lacha la Pass in the Zanskar Range.
• The rough patches of Darcha and Zingzingbar will give you an adrenaline boost. You will also get to spend some time near Chandrabhaga river (also known as Chenab) so make sure that you have a camera handy and take mesmerizing pictures.
• En route, you can visit Suraj Taal and Deepak Taal, two breath-taking lakes in the Lahaul and Spiti region. Once you reach Sarchu, relax and retire for the night.
• Overnight Stay: SARCHU
• Meals : Breakfast & Dinner

DAY 05: SARCHU - LEH | 250 KM | 6-7 HOURS.

• Today, start your journey towards Leh, the hub of Ladakh region.
• The route will take you through Nakeela Pass, Whisky Nallah, Lachulung La Pass, Pang, More Plains, and Tanglang La Pass.
• When you reach Leh, check in at the accommodation and stay overnight.
• Overnight Stay at Leh.
• Meals : Breakfast & Dinner

DAY 06: LEH - KARDUNG LA PASS - NUBRA VALLEY | 120 KM | 4-5 HOURS.

• Wake up to a refreshing morning and travel to Nubra Valley, a cold desert with vast landscapes and mountain ranges.
• Feel the thrill of crossing one of the highest motorable passes in the world, Khardung La.
• Once you reach Nubra, enjoy a camel ride in the Desert Mountains of Hunder (additional cost).
• Overnight Stay in Swiss Camps at Nubra.
• Meals : Breakfast & Dinner

DAY 07: NUBRA VALLEY - TURTUK VILLAGE - NUBRA VALLEY | 200 KM | 8-9 HOURS.

• After the sun peeps out, you will pack your bags as you will leave for Turtuk village which was under Pakistan before 1971.
• Nestled in the Nubra tehsil, 205 km from the Leh town, on the banks of the Shyok River, it is the last village before LOC. With stunning beauty throughout the valley, you will be blessed with views you might have not seen before.
• After exploring Turtuk you will travel back towards Nubra.
• Overnight Stay in Swiss Camps at Nubra.
• Meals : Breakfast & Dinner

DAY 08: NUBRA VALLEY - PANGONG LAKE | 160 KM | 7-8 HOURS.

• Prepare for another day of a daring off-road experience as you traverse through untamed paths in the high mountains.
• The route leads to the beautiful Pangong Tso (lake) via Shyok River or Wari La Pass. It is quite challenging yet thrilling and is generally used by the army.
• On arrival, train your sights on the enchanting blue lake. (*In case Pangong Tso is closed then we shall ride back to Leh and do the day excursion to Pangong Tso on the next day in SUV/tempo traveler.)
• Once you reach Pangong Tso, enjoy the picturesque lake and magnificent views surrounding you.
• Enjoy an overnight stay at Pangong Tso.
• Meals : Breakfast & Dinner

DAY 09: PANGONG LAKE - LEH VIA KELA PASS | 160 KM | 5-6 HOURS.

• In the morning, get set for yet another journey exhilarating ride as you head back to Leh, via Chang La pass (the third highest mountain pass in the world) and Choglamsar.
• En route, stop at the famous Druk White Lotus School, featured in the blockbuster Bollywood movie ‘3 Idiots’ and Shanti Stupa, a beautiful white-domed Buddhist stupa surrounded by stunning scenery of vast mountains.
• If time permits, you can even visit Magnetic Hill, War Memorial, and Gurudwara Pathar Sahib.
• Overnight stay will be provided in Leh.
• Meals : Breakfast & Dinner

DAY 10: LEH – KARGIL | 240 KM | 6-7 HOURS.

• As soon as the morning unfolds today, you will embark the bike expedition to Leh Ladakh, which involves exploring the town of Kargil. You can visit the Buddhist monastery of Lamayuru, which is settled at a height 3,510 m.
• Later drive on Fotu La mountain pass and then drive to Kargil.
• Overnight Stay at Kargil.
• Meals : Breakfast & Dinner

DAY 11: KARGIL - SRINAGAR | 220 KM | 5-6 HOURS.

• After having breakfast, we start riding towards Srinagar.
• Enroute, we will be passing the second coldest inhabited place in the world, Drass.
• You will have amazing views of Kargil, Tiger Hill and other famous peaks from the Kargil War, You will also cross the famous Zoji La and arrive at Srinagar by the evening.
• Overnight Stay in hotel at Srinagar.
• Meals : Breakfast & Dinner

DAY 12: DEPARTURE FROM SRINAGAR.

• Have breakfast and explore the mesmerising Srinagar on your own.
• You may visit numerous attractions such as Shalimar Bagh and take a Shikara ride on the picturesque Dal Lake (on your own).
• Later catch your Flight/Train for your onward journey.
• Meals: Breakfast
